The Astoria Performing Arts Center presents "Blood Brothers" a Tony Nominated and Oliver Award Winning Best Musical about two brothers who grow up just block apart, but in very different worlds. The two men, unaware they are actually twin brothers, becomes close friends until they both call in love with the same girl.

The play will run May 2 to 18, with performances on Thursdays and Fridays at 8 p.m. and Saturday showtimes at 2 p.m. and 8 p.m. Tickets are $18, $12 for seniors and students.
